"subjection" meaning in Old French

See subjection in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

Forms: subjection oblique singular or [canonical, feminine], subjections [oblique, plural], subjection [nominative, singular], subjections [nominative, plural]
Etymology: Borrowed from Latin subjectiō. Etymology templates: {{bor|fro|la|subjectiō}} Latin subjectiō Head templates: {{fro-noun|f}} subjection oblique singular, f (oblique plural subjections, nominative singular subjection, nominative plural subjections)
  1. subjection; state of being subjected Synonyms: subjectiun, subjectioun, subjeccion, subjeccioun, subjeciun, subjecciun, subjecion
